The core insight
High-anxiety education tools will make mistakes. A public changelog turns frantic iteration into evidence; an error log turns prediction misses into learning; a postmortem turns angry users into the next cohort of trust signals.
What to publish
Publish model version changes, data-source changes, known edge cases, shift-level sample warnings, outage notes, prediction error ranges and result-day accuracy reports. Link these notes from calculator and predictor pages before users have to hunt for them.
Risk and reproducibility
This playbook is highly reusable, but only if the team is honest. Changelogs become liability when they hide failures, inflate accuracy or use vague language to avoid explaining data quality limits.
